Actor Asif Ali has demanded the return of those who resigned from the star-studded organisation AMMA in connection with the attack on the actress. The actress had resigned from AMMA in 2018 after being attacked. Geethu Mohandas, Rima Kallingal and Remya Nambeesan had also resigned from AMMA in solidarity with the actress.
Asif Ali, who is also the executive member of AMMA, said that the members who had quit, should return and that the ICC, which was set up 4 years back, will now come into existence. He said that though the actress is not a member of the organisation, she is active in the film industry.
Talking about inaction against rape accused, actor and producer Vijay Babu, Asif Ali said that there is a limitation in taking action under AMMA’s rules and that action cannot be taken outright. Asif Ali made this clear in an interview with Manorama Online.
